Weg S.A. (OTCMKTS:WEGZY – Get Free Report) was the target of a significant increase in short interest in December. As of December 31st, there was short interest totalling 51,400 shares, an increase of 180.9% from the December 15th total of 18,300 shares. Based on an average daily volume of 64,300 shares, the short-interest ratio is currently 0.8 days.

WEG Company Profile
WEG SA engages in the production and sale of capital goods in Brazil and internationally. The company offers electric motors, generators, and transformers; gear units and geared motors; hydraulic and steam turbines; frequency converters; motor starters and maneuver devices; control and protection of electric circuits for industrial automation; power sockets and switches; and electric traction solutions for heavy vehicles, SUV vehicles, locomotives, and sea transportation capital goods.
